In the ever-evolving landscape of the digital world, responsive web design has emerged as a critical component of web development. With an array of devices ranging from smartphones and tablets to laptops and desktops, ensuring that a website provides an optimal viewing experience across all platforms is paramount. The central goal of responsive web design is to create a seamless user experience, regardless of the device being used.
The importance of responsive web design cannot be overstated. As mobile internet usage continues to rise, it has become essential for websites to cater to the smaller screens of smartphones and tablets without compromising on functionality or aesthetics. A responsive design dynamically adjusts the layout based on the size and orientation of the user’s screen. This adaptability not only enhances user experience but also positively impacts search engine rankings, as search engines like Google prioritize mobile-friendly sites.
At the core of responsive web design is a mix of flexible grids and layouts, images, and intelligent use of CSS media queries. These elements work together to ensure that as a user switches from a laptop to an iPad or a smartphone, the website will automatically accommodate for resolution, image size, and scripting abilities. This fluidity means that a single design can serve users with vastly different device capabilities, making it a cost-effective solution for businesses.
Implementing responsive design involves several key strategies. First, flexible layouts use relative length units, such as percentages, rather than fixed units like pixels. This allows the layout to adjust seamlessly to different screen sizes. Additionally, flexible images and media need to scale within their containing elements, preventing overflow and ensuring that visuals remain crisp and accessible.
Media queries are another vital tool. They allow developers to apply specific styles based on conditions like screen width or device orientation. By using breakpoints—specific points at which the site’s layout changes to accommodate different screen sizes—designers can create a more tailored experience for users on smaller devices.
Beyond the technical aspects, a responsive design also requires a shift in content strategy. It's crucial to prioritize content and features that are most important for mobile users, ensuring that key actions and information are easily accessible. This often involves simplifying navigation and minimizing the need for zooming or horizontal scrolling, which can frustrate users on mobile devices.
The benefits of responsive web design extend beyond improved usability. By offering a consistent experience across all devices, businesses can ensure brand coherence and enhance user trust. Furthermore, maintaining a single responsive website is often more manageable and cost-effective than maintaining separate sites for desktop and mobile users.
In today's fast-paced digital environment, where consumers expect fast, seamless, and visually engaging web experiences, adapting to every device is no longer a luxury—it's a necessity. Investing in responsive web design is not just about keeping up with technology trends; it's about staying ahead in a competitive market by providing an engaging and effective user experience across all platforms.
As technology continues to evolve, responsive web design will remain a cornerstone of web development, ensuring that websites are equipped to meet the growing demands of a diverse range of devices and user preferences.